illuminating Change Photographic Competition

11 May 2012

The Illuminating Change Photographic Competition, held annually by the Wits Transformation Office, has brought forth an interesting array of entries from staff and students this year. With the aim of capturing the spirit of transformation on campus and translate the vastly diverse understanding of what Wits means to the entire Wits community, the 2012 winners were announced during WALE 5.0, where an exhibit of a selection of images and were held. The keynote speaker at the event was award-winning photographer Peter McKenzie. The winning photograph was taken by Frederick Mabitsela entitled The revolution will not be televised. It will be live.
